Lil Uzi Vert Says His $24 Million Forehead Diamond Was Ripped Out While Crowd Surfing

The rapper revealed this week that the pink gemstone he got pierced into his head earlier this year was "ripped" out during a music festival in Miami.
|

We can’t even imagine the headache Lil Uzi Vert must’ve had after this. 

The rapper shared a cringeworthy anecdote this week, telling TMZ that the massive $24 million pink diamond he had pierced into his forehead was ripped out while he was crowd surfing at a recent music festival in Miami. 

When asked about his infamous 10-carat diamond, the rapper said, “I had a show at Rolling Loud, and I jumped into the crowd and they kind of ripped it out.”

Luckily he still has the diamond, but he’s since replaced his forehead piercing with a metal bar.

Earlier this year, the rapper tweeted that he’d purchased expensive gem and then later shared on Instagram that he got it embedded into his forehead.

It appeared to have been removed months later, and then was put back in prior to the music festival.
